Pool safety fence installation involves setting up a secure barrier around a swimming pool to prevent accidental access by children, pets, or unauthorized individuals. These fences are typically made from durable materials like mesh, aluminum, or vinyl, and are designed to be both sturdy and visually unobtrusive. Professional service providers assess the size and layout of the property to recommend the most effective fencing solutions, ensuring that the barrier meets safety standards and complements the property's aesthetic. Proper installation is essential to create a reliable boundary that minimizes the risk of accidental drownings or injuries.
Many common problems that pool safety fences help address include the risk of young children wandering into the pool area unsupervised, pets gaining access to the water, or unauthorized entry by visitors. Without a proper barrier, pools can pose significant safety hazards, especially in homes with young children or elderly family members. Installing a high-quality fence creates a physical obstacle that discourages unsupervised access, providing peace of mind for homeowners and reducing the likelihood of accidents. Service providers can also advise on the best height, gate locking mechanisms, and fencing materials to maximize safety and durability.

The overview below groups typical Pool Safety Fence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Basic fence repairs or partial installations typically range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and materials used.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Standard Fence Installation - Installing a new safety fence around a standard-sized pool gener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most local contractors handle projects in this range, with costs varying based on fence height, material, and complexity.
Full Fence Replacement - Replacing an existing fence with a new safety barrier can range from $3,000 to $5,500. Larger or more elaborate projects tend to push into this higher tier, though many jobs stay within the mid-range.
Custom or Complex Projects - Highly customized or complex installations, such as custom designs or multi-area fences, can exceed $5,000. These projects are less common and typically involve additional materials or features that increase cost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
